In the ongoing human ritual of world-building through miniature craft and rule-bound conflict, Games Workshop has turned its attention once more to the devotees of excess — releasing new Warhammer Age of Sigmar boxed sets centered on the Slaanesh Hedonites faction. The announcement, accompanied by an updated General's Handbook, signals not merely a cosmetic gesture but a substantive reimagining of how these armies exist both on the table and in the imagination.
